Dan asked if there would be validation for profiles. Valerie replied that there should be a customized version of the schemas that would allow validation for profiles.

Chris commented that open labyrinth uses everything, but right now VP Sim does not. They plan to implement in the future.

JB commented that the linear group seems to be having trouble with multiple-choice questions and QTI. He added that QTI sounds like a complicated spec. He questioned whether that was an area that the group should put some work into. Dan added that they were also planning to use QTI for representing quizzes.

Valerie commented the QTI questions can be incorporated using Xtensible info. There is an example in the specification describing how to do that. She added that QTI was complex for a good reason: assessment is complex. If the working group were to develop specifications related to assessment, whatever we came up with would likely be equally as complex.
